KENTUCKY PIE
Steps:
- 1. To make the crust: In a food processor, pulse the flour, salt, and sugar to mix. Add the butter and pulse until the mixture resembles coarse meal with pea-sized pieces. Sprinkle the ice water on top and pulse until large clumps form. Press the dough into a disk, wrap tightly in plastic wrap, and refrigerate until firm, about 1 hour. 2. On a lightly floured work surface, roll the dough into a 12-inch round. Fit into a 9-inch pie dish. Tuck in the overhang and decoratively crimp the edges. Freeze while heating the oven. 3. Preheat the oven to 350°F. Prick the bottom of the dough all over with a fork. Line with parchment paper and fill with pie weights or dried beans. Bake until the is golden and dry, about 20 minutes. Remove the parchment and pie weights. Return the crust to the oven and continue baking until golden brown, about 5 minutes. Let cool slightly on a wire rack. 4. Meanwhile, make the filling: In a large bowl, whisk the eggs and sugar. Continue whisking while adding the butter, then the bourbon. Stir in the flour until well combined. Stir in the walnuts and chocolate chips. Pour into the warm pie shell. 5. Bake until the filling is set and the top golden, about 30 minutes. Cool in the pan on a wire rack. Serve warm or room temperature.
DECADENT KENTUCKY PIE
Hailing from the famous Kentucky Derby, this pie is a variation of its dessert. Made with a graham cracker crust rather than a pastry, the decadence still comes through in every slice. Every bite will produce mmmmm's with the rich flavor and chewy, but delicate texture. See alternate ingredients at bottom of recipe for variations of this recipe.

Steps:
- Preheat oven to 325.
- Mix sugar and flour in a large bowl. Set aside.
- Add nuts, eggs, butter, chocolate chips, and vanilla to sugar-flour mixture. Mix together.
- Pour this mixture into prepared pie crust.
- Bake for one hour.
- Cool completely.
- Variations:.
- Use mint chocolate chips or butterscotch chips instead of chocolate chips.
- Use 2 teaspoons of rum or bourbon instead of vanilla.

THE 10 MOST FAMOUS KENTUCKY DISHES - THE SPRUCE EATS
From thespruceeats.com
Occupation Cookbook Author And PhotographerPublished 2019-08-22Estimated Reading Time 6 mins
- Kentucky Derby Pie. This great Kentucky Derby pie is rich and deliciously decadent. The famed is a delicious combination of chocolate chips and walnuts in a sweet, buttery filling.
- The Mint Julep. The mint julep is a time-honored sweetened Kentucky cocktail traditionally served at the Kentucky Derby, which runs annually on the first Saturday in May.
- Kentucky Benedictine Spread or Dip. Benedictine is another famous dish from Louisville, Kentucky. The spread—or dip—was created by Jennie Benedict, a caterer and household editor for the Louisville Courier-Journal.
- Southern Wilted Lettuce (Kilt Lettuce) This "kilt" (or killed) lettuce salad will bring back fond childhood memories to people who grew up in the Appalachian region of Kentucky.
- Kentucky Bread Pudding With Bourbon Sauce. This fabulous bread pudding was shared by the Beaumont Inn of Harrodsburg, Kentucky. According to Nick Sundberg, the inn's chef at the time, the bread pudding was a favorite at Sunday brunch.
- Bourbon Balls. Whiskey is made all over the world, but 95 percent of the world's bourbon comes from Kentucky. These sweet, slightly boozy bourbon balls are always a hit, and they are a delicious treat to make for holiday parties and gifts.
- Owensboro Mutton Barbecue. Head to the Western Kentucky city of Owensboro for their unique mutton barbecue. The Moonlite Bar-B-Q Inn and Old Hickory Bar-B-Q are two of the oldest barbecue restaurants in Owensboro, and they both offer mutton, beef, pork, and chicken.
- Burgoo. There doesn't seem to be a definitive answer to how this stew came to be called "burgoo." Some say it might come from the French, as in bourguignon, while others claim it is named after an oatmeal porridge which was eaten by British sailors as early as 1700.
- The Hot Brown Sandwich. Create in 1926, the hot brown sandwich has long been a Kentucky tradition. The sandwich was invented by Fred K. Schmidt, a chef at Louisville's Brown Hotel.
- Kentucky Butter Cake. The Kentucky butter cake is so moist and rich that it needs no other embellishments. The rich buttermilk pound cake bakes in a Bundt or tube cake pan.
